A formula is given in terms of secondary characteristic classes for the leading order contribution to the spectral flow for a path of twisted Dirac operators on an odd dimensional, Riemannian manifold when the twisting is done by a path of unitary connections with large curvature.

This paper proves exponential mixing for frame flows on hyperbolic manifolds with cusps.

problem Establishing exponential mixing for frame flows on geometrically finite hyperbolic manifolds with cusps.
method Symbolic coding of geodesic flow, Dolgopyat's method, large deviation property, combinatorics of cusp excursions, renewal theorem.
result Frame flows for geometrically finite hyperbolic manifolds of arbitrary dimensions are exponentially mixing.

Let M be a non-elementary convex cocompact hyperbolic 3 manifold and delta the critical exponent of its fundamental group. We prove that a one-dimensional unipotent flow for the frame bundle of M is ergodic for the Burger-Roblin measure provided that delta>1.
